What is an authorization hold?

If you use your Card at an automated fuel dispenser ("pay at the pump"), the merchant may preauthorize the transaction amount (place a hold) on your Card Account of up to $75.00 or more. This may cause your Card to be declined even though you have sufficient funds on your Card to pay for the transaction. If this happens, pay for your purchase inside and tell the cashier exactly how much you want to spend. If you use your Card at a restaurant, a hotel, for a car rental purchase, or for similar purchases, the merchant or we may preauthorize the transaction amount for the purchase amount plus up to 20% or more to ensure there are sufficient funds available to cover tips or incidental expenses incurred. Any preauthorization amount will place a "hold" on your available funds until the merchant sends us the final payment amount of your purchase. Once the final payment amount is received, the preauthorization amount on "hold" will be removed. It may take up to thirty-five (35) days for the "hold" to be removed. During the hold period, you will not have access to the preauthorized amount. If you authorize a transaction and then fail to make a purchase of that item as planned, the approval may result in a hold for that amount of funds for up to thirty (30) days. All transactions relating to car rentals may result in a hold for that amount of funds for up to sixty (60) days.
